LACLEDE ELEM. is a primary school of modestly sized scale in ST LOUIS, Missouri, part of ST. LOUIS CITY, caters to 264 students in grades pre-K through 8.
ST. LOUIS CITY comprises 62 schools with combined enrollment of 17,933 students; LACLEDE ELEM. is among them.
On demographics, LACLEDE ELEM. shows that 99% of students identify as Black, making the school strongly Black-majority. By comparison, St. Louis city as a whole is about 42% Black, so the school skews meaningfully more Black than its surroundings.
In terms of school funding signals, Staff filings list 18 full-time-equivalent teachers, which works out to roughly 14.7:1 students per teacher. That figure is higher than the state norm's 12.4:1 average. About 100% of enrolled students meet the income threshold for free or reduced-price lunch, which schools and policymakers use as a rough income-mix signal.
On a residual basis (actual vs predicted given the student mix), LACLEDE ELEM. performs roughly as the BeatsExpectations model predicts for a school with this FRL share. The predicted value is around 49.4%, the actual is 39.8%, a residual of -9.6 points.
Zooming out to the county, ACS estimates for St. Louis city put the typical household earns roughly $56,160 per year, about 41% of the adult population holds a bachelor's degree or above, and census figures put the poverty rate at about 15%. In all, St. Louis city runs 113 public schools (combined enrollment of about 29,941 students), of which LACLEDE ELEM. is one.
Nearest neighbor: BARACK OBAMA ELEMENTARY SCHOOL, around 1.1 miles off. Within five miles, there are 8 other public schools. On composite proficiency, LACLEDE ELEM. comes 5th of 8 in the immediate cluster, below the nearby-schools average of 44.0%.
Geographically, the school is in an inner-city area.
Over the past 7-year window. LACLEDE ELEM.'s enrollment has increased 29% since 2018, when it stood at 204 (now 264). Class-load math has rose: from 13.2:1 in 2018 to 14.7:1 in 2025.
